Miscellaneous Committees minute book
CCA/1/4/8/1/4
31 Mar 1884 - 23 Nov 1897
item
Coventry Archives & Research Centre
Meeting of owners and ratepayers to consent to promote in the present Session of Parliament a Bill to carry in to effect agreement to purchase by the Corporation the Undertaking of the Coventry Gas Company, 31 Mar 1884, Council in Committee to read report from Gas Committee that advertisement be placed in local papers for tenders for loans, 8 Apr 1884, General Works Committee and Sanitary Committee - received tenders for the erection of the Fever Hospital, 16 Apr 1884, 21 Apr 1884, 14 Jul 1884, Council in Committee relating to the transfer of the Gas Undertaking to the Corporation - empowered to borrow from Lloyds Barnetts and Bosanquets Bank amounts as may be required, 17 Jun 1884, Meeting Estates Committee and Finance Committee instructing any Committees to report to the Council any outlay of money above £20 to the Town Clerk, 21 Jul 1884, Joint Committee of the General Works Committee and Sanitary Committee - considered report relating to the sewage of the Red Lane District, 10 Sep 1885, 29 Oct 1885, 1 Jun 1886, 8 Jul 1886, 13 Jul 1886, 30 Aug 1886, 7 Oct 1886, Meeting Estates Committee and Market Hall Committee - considered application of Mr Josiah Mattocks, Mayor's Crier, for increase in salary, 21 Sep 1885, Meeting Estates Committee and General Works Committee - that annual appointments of tradesmen be made by the Estates Committee to get any work or goods supplied on tender, 21 Dec 1885, Colonial and Indian Exhibition Committee to read letter from Secretary of Royal Commission for exhibition - ordered Town Clerk to write to Messrs Thomas Cook and Son for details on visits of working men to exhibition, fares, board and lodging in London, 6 Jan 1886, 12 Jan 1886, Council in Committee - passed the minutes of the General Works Committee and considered the resolution of the unemployed for an extension of employment, 24 Mar 1886, Waterworks Finance Committee - considered appointing a Collector of Water Rents for Saint Michael's Parish, 20 Apr 1886, 4 May 1886, Joint Committee of the General Works and Sanitary Committee regarding the transfer of the parishes of Saint Michael and Holy Trinity from the Rural Sanitary Authority to the Urban Sanitary District, 6 May 1886, Council in Committee regarding letter from Lord Chancellor's Secretary on proposed appointment of new magistrates, 26 Jul 1886, Council in Committee - to select person for Mayor, 28 Sep 1886, Queen Victoria Jubilee Celebration Committee, 11 Jan 1887, 27 Jan 1887, 17 Feb 1887, 19 Aug 1887, Committee appointed relating to the establishment of a County Police Station at the County Hall, Coventry, 31 Mar 1887 Joint Committee of the General Works Committee and Sanitary Committee relating to enquiries being made in other towns in respect of public slaughterhouses, 5 Apr 1887, 14 Jun 1887, 28 Jun 1887, 9 Aug 1887, 2 Apr 1889, 16 Apr 1889, Committee appointed to draw up an address of congratulations to the Queen on her Jubilee, 2 Jun 1887, Council in Committee appointed to look into purchasing 53 and 54 Smithford Street for additional approach to the Market Hall, 13 Sep 1887, Meeting of the Estates Committee and Finance Committment to consider an application for increase in salary, 21 Dec 1887, 26 Jun 1889, 11 Feb 1891, Meeting convened to consider inviting Warwickshire Agricultural Society to hold their show in Coventry, 13 Jan 1888, 11 Jan 1889, 5 Jan 1894, Local [Agricultural] Committee formed to make arrangements, 13 Jan 1888, 8 Feb 1889, 8 Jan 1894, 26 Jan 1894, 16 Feb 1894, Council in Committee to consider plan for additions to and alterations of the baths including cost of repairs amounting to £5497, 9 Feb 1888, Council in Committee appointed Committee to consider The Local Government [England and Wales] Bill and Town Clerk's Report, 2 May 1888, Meeting of the Joint Watch Committee and General Works Committee to consider the question of nuisances from tramway engines, 4 Dec 1888, Meeting of the grocers and provision dealers to approve opening times of shops in the city, 5 Feb 1889, 26 Feb 1889, Meeting Joint General Works Committee and Market Hall Committee - appointed Sub Committee to consider plan for alterations to the Market Hall tower for fixing a Greenwich Indicator, 19 Feb 1889, Watch Committee and Fire Brigade Committee considering the question of providing a second Steam Fire Engine, 26 Feb 1889, Sub Committee of the Joint General Works Committee and Sanitary Committee relating to site for public slaughterhouse and to form deputation to see Directors of the Coventry Public Cattle Sales Company, 18 Mar 1889, 1 Apr 1889, Meeting of Sanitary Committee in conference with managers of schools and teachers relating to closing day and Sunday Schools in view of spread of measles, 6 Jul 1889, Joint Watch Committee and Sanitary Committee relating to terms for telephone communication from National Telephone Company Limited, 9 Jul 1889, 16 Jul 1889, Council in Committee to study report of the General Works Committee re plans for buildings to be erected on open spaces, 2 Jul 1889, Joint Watch Committee and General Works Committee appointed to consider the dangers and annoyances arising from the working of the tramway and steam engines, 12 Sep 1889, 17 Sep 1889, Council in Committee to appoint members of the Council to the Committee of Visitors of the Pauper Lunatic Asylum at Hatton, 22 Oct 1889, Council accompanied by Trustees of the Bablake Boys Charity - inspected the course and height of the proposed siding from the Nuneaton Railway into the Gas Works, 26 Nov 1889, Meeting of the Estates Committee and Recreation Grounds Committee to consider erection of gymnasia in the public recreation grounds of the City, 12 Dec 1889, Joint meeting Estates Committee and General Works Committee considering applying to the Local Government Board to include Stoke within the boundary of the City, 24 Dec 1889, Joint meeting of the Watch Committee and General Works Committee relating to the public lamps and appointment of a Gas Analyst or Examiner, 7 Jan 1890, Committee appointed to consider report on the proposed Gas Siding, 5 Mar 1890, 24 Apr 1890, 11 Mar 1891, 13 May 1892, Committee to consider letter from Clerk of County Council proposing meeting of sub-committees of County and Cities of Birmingham and Coventry as to financial adjustment, 11 Mar 1890, 21 May 1890, 16 Jun 1890, Meeting of Boundary Committee relating to the copy letter of the County Boundaries Committee to the Local Government Board claiming to retain in the county the railway station and main line east and the Leamington Railway and Coventry Park, other parts of St.Michael's Parish, Whitmore Park and Holy Trinity parish, 31 Mar 1890, 23 Apr 1890, Council in Committee resolved that the Chief Constable be selected from among Inspectors of the Force, 2 Apr 1890, Gulson Address Committee - inspected illuminated address and ornamental box for Alderman Gulson with the instruction to make stand with glass case for the box, 2 Sep 1890, Standing Order Committee appointed, 23 Sep 1890, 30 Sep 1890, Council in Committee - that the profits of the Gas Undertaking be applied in relief of the General District Rate, 14 Oct 1890, Equitable Adjustment Committee, 23 Oct 1890, 30 Oct 1890, 25 Nov 1890, Council in Committee - expressing thanks on the long connection between Mr. Browett as Town Clerk of Coventry and Corporation, and determining that in future the Town Clerk devotes his whole time to duties of office, 26 Jan 1891, Meeting General Works Committee and Waterworks Committee to consider duties and renumeration of City Surveyor, 9 Feb 1891, 17 Feb 1891, Meeting of the Estates Committee and Finance Committment regarding the City Accountant's salary, 11 Feb 1891, 21 Sep 1891, 5 Oct 1891, 10 Jul 1893, Sub Committee of the Joint General Works Committee and Waterworks Committee appointed to consider City Surveyor's salary, and that an Assistant Surveyor and Clerk be appointed, 18 Feb 1891, Committee appointed to report to the Council on the salary for the Town Clerkship, 27 Jan 1891, 10 Feb 1891, 13 Feb 1891, 22 Mar 1893, Joint Committee of General Works Committee and Waterworks Committee relating to the salaries of Surveyor and Assistant Surveyor, 24 Feb 1891, Council in Committee re approval for the Town Clerk to continue longer in office and the appointment by him of an assistant, 16 Feb 1891, Meeting of the General Purposes Committee to consider applications of officials' salaries, 4 Mar 1891, 7 Oct 1891, 15 Dec 1891, 22 Feb 1892, 22 Aug 1892, 8 Mar 1893, Council in Committee - agreed that £1102 being equal to Borough Rate of 2d in the £ be transferred from Waterworks Fund to Borough Fund, 20 Apr 1891, Council in Committee meeting with reference to the qualification and fitness of four candidates for the position of Assistant Surveyor, 9 Jun 1891, Meeting of the Financial Adjustment Committee, 2 Jul 1891, 17 Jul 1891, 27 Jul 1891, 7 Oct 1891, 18 Nov 1891, 10 Feb 1892, Council in Committee authorising the Gas Committee to draw up a report relating to the future gas supply, 27 Jul 1891, Joint meeting of the Baths Committee and Market Hall Committee - that the site of the new baths in Pool Meadow be let for the usual Whitsuntide Fair, 25 Jan 1892, Joint meeting of the Estates Committee and Waterworks Committee - ordered that £1161 be transferred from the Waterworks Income Fund to the Borough Fund in relief of the Borough Rate, 12 Apr 1892, Council in Committee - recommend adoption of report of the General Works Committee regarding the sewage disposal, 24 Aug 1892, 1 Sep 1892, Sub Committee of the General Works Committee and Sanitary Committee instructing the Surveyor to prepare estimate for the erection of a destructor or destructors, 31 Aug 1892, 16 Mar 1893, 20 Mar 1893, 29 Mar 1893, 18 Apr 1893, Council in Committee instructed to prepare detailed plans and estimates for a scheme of road irrigation in the Avon Valley with special attention to the outfall sewer to the Whitley Well, 9 Sep 1892, 2 Jan 1893, 6 Jul 1893, Council in Committee regarding the non use of St. Mary's Hall for bazaars, sales of work or private balls, and that Estates Committee draw up and submit new regulations for future use, 28 Nov 1892, General Purpose Committee re the appointment of a Royal Commission on the Poor Law, also the Circular of the Local Government Board as to pauperism and distress, 3 Jan 1893, 27 Sep 1893, Council in Committee - appointed Sub-Committee to take charge of the proceedings for obtaining a provisional order for the acquisition of land for Sewage Deposal according to Mr Mansagh's plan, 30 Jan 1893, Sewage Sub Committee relating to witness on behalf of the Corporation, 30 Jan 1893, 2 Feb 1893, 16 Feb 1893, General Purpose Committee - considered circular of the Association of Municipal Corporations and that in future the General Purpose Committee be called together each year to consider what subject should be brought before the Annual Meeting, 3 Feb 1893, Town Clerkship Committee , 5 Apr 1893, 15 Apr 1893, Council in Committee relating to letter and report of Local Government Board re application for compulsory purchase of lands for sewage disposal, 15 May 1893, General Purpose Committee - recommend to Council illuminated address of congratulations be presented to HRH the Duke of York and the Princess Mary of Teck on the occasion of their marriage, 31 Jun 1893, Council in committee relating to the disposal of sewage, 4 Jul 1893, General Purpose Committee regarding the Rivers Pollution Prevention [No2] Bill - recommend a petition to the House of Common against it, also alterations to the City byelaws, 25 Jul 1893, Meeting General Purpose Committee re the discharge and amalgamation of the Estates Committee and Finance Committee, together with the formation of an Electric Light Committee, 27 Sep 1893, 9 Oct 1893, General Purpose Committee to read circular from Local Government Board with reference to the unemployed and letter of Coventry and District Trades and Labour Council - Board of Guardians requested to obtain particulars of the extent of distress in the city, 19 Oct 1893, 30 Oct 1893, 29 Nov 1893, Charities Committee appointed re alleged payments due from the Corporation to certain charities, 13 Nov 1893, Private meeting on invitation of the mayor to elect a committee to consider the distress "among the more descerning of the artisans of the city", 27 Nov 1893, Artisans Assistance Committee- resolved that a Fund be started in privately assisting artisans in distress through temporary unemployment caused by depression of trade, 29 Nov 1893, 1 Dec 1893, Council in Committee to consider giving notice of any business on behalf of Coventry at forthcoming meeting of Association of Municipal Corporation, 1 Feb 1894, Meeting of Local Committee of the Warwickshire County Council and the Council of the County Borough of Coventry to hold a public enquiry on Local Government Act 1894, 18 May 1894, Public Meeting convened by the Mayor that a Towns Committee be appointed to promote a course of Popular Science Lectures for the people in the autumn under the Gilchrist Educational Trust, 22 May 1894, 3 Apr 1895, 18 Jan 1897, Meeting of the joint Committee to consider order of retirement of members of Board of Guardians after three years, under the Local Government Act 1894, 25 May 1894, General Purpose Committee - the Committees of the Council to be elected on 9th November or within three days thereafter and that the Town Clerk make enquiries in other towns on the election of Committees, 28 May 1894, 11 Jun 1894, Meeting General Charities Committee - considered draft scheme for the regulation of the General Charities put before the Council and agreed on report recommending the Council to increase the representative trustees from three to five, 8 Aug 1894, Public Meeting of the Inhabitants of the City convened by the mayor to consider the desirability of taking steps to procure additional railway communication for the City, 12 Feb 1895, 1 Oct 1895, General Purpose Committee - received deputation from the Board of Guardians on the question of the present want of employment in the City, 14 Feb 1895, Conference held between Local Authorities - that it be desirable to interchange between districts information as to cases of infectious diseases which seem likely to cause danger outside the respective districts, 15 Feb 1895, Railway Committee appointed to draw up a letter for the next meeting of the Midland Railway Company, 18 Feb 1895, 25 Feb 1895, 7 Mar 1895, 18 Apr 1895, 4 Nov 1895, Joint Meeting of the Estates Committee and Market Hall Committee to recommend the appointment of Mr. H.J. Cramp, City Crier and Market Hall Assistant, 20 Mar 1895, Meeting General Purpose Committee - to consider letter from Secretary of New Decimal Association with regard to metric system of weights and measures, 7 May 1895, Meeting to inspect the competitive designs for municipal buildings, 10 Jun 1895, Council in Committee to consider report of the General Works Committee on sewage disposal, 17 Jul 1895, 30 Jul 1895, 3 Sep 1895, Joint meeting of the Estates Committee, Finance Committee and Watch Committee to consider plans for municipal buildings, a sub committee appointed to report on the best means of carrying out the above and to find alternative accommodation for the Fire Brigade, 2 Oct 1895, Joint Sub Committee - considered the plans for municipal buildings and for the preparation of plans for the Fire Brigade to move to the old Baths, together with the recommendation to proceed with the whole of the plans for the Police Building, 7 Oct 1895, 18 Nov 1895, 19 Nov 1895, 28 Nov 1895, 2 Dec 1895, 2 Dec 1895, General Purposes Committee - considered approaching annual meeting of the Municipal Corporations, 17 Dec 1895, 22 Dec 1896, General Purpose Committee - selected Sub Committee to watch the proposal to put a tax upon cycles and to take action as necessary, also considered letter from the Town Clerk of West Ham regarding School Board expenditure, 3 Feb 1895, Council Meeting - resolved that the Mayor be requested to convene meeting of the clergy and ministers and others with a view to collection being made in churches etc., in aid of the fund for the relief of distress etc., 2 Mar 1896, Cycle Tax Sub Committee, 23 Mar 1896, Sewage Sub Committee, 5 May 1896, 11 May 1896, Meeting of Special Committee - considered the means at the disposal of the City to deal with large fires and ordered that a plan of the City on the 1/2500 scale be prepared showing the sizes of the water main and position of hydrants, 30 Jul 1896, 12 Oct 1896, Inhabitants of the City - recorded the outrages which have been inflicted on Armenians "by the order or connivance of the Sultan" and to ensure the Government of their support in drastic measures to remove such atrocities, 21 Sep 1896, Joint meeting of the General Works Committee and Sanitary Committee to prepare a practical scheme for building tenements in blocks from time to time for those made homeless by sanitary reasons, 29 Sep 1896, Citizens Dwellings Sub Committee - instructs the Town Clerk to prepare an abstract of the Housing of the Working Classes Act 1890 with a copy to each member of the Sub Committee and to obtain information from other towns as to the working of the Act, 29 Sep 1896, 17 Nov 1896, 30 Nov 1896, 22 Dec 1896, 11 Jan 1897, 25 Jan 1897, 29 Mar 1897, 28 Apr 1897, 26 May 1897, 6 Jul 1897, Joint meeting of the General Works Committee and Sanitary Committee to consult an architect to obtain sketch plans and estimates, 29 Dec 1896, General Purpose Committee - appointed committee with powers to add to their number either from the Council or general public, to take steps to celebrate the Diamond Jubilee of the Queen, 11 Jan 1897, Celebration Committee, 11 Feb 1897, 11 Feb 1897, Town meeting with a view to raising a subscription for the relief of sufferers from famine in India, 24 Feb 1897, General Purpose Committee - while generally approving of the principals of superannuation are not of the opinion that the financial aspect of the scheme of the Bill are sufficiently clear to advise the Council of its support, 5 Apr 1897, General Purpose Committee - recommend that the Council appoint Mayor Alderman Tomson a Governor of Nason University College under S17 of Nason University College Act 1897; also received communication from Town Clerk of Huddersfield with respect to the election of Aldermen, 8 Sep 1897, Meeting of the Joint Sub Committee asking the City Engineer to prepare and submit to the sub-committee a scheme for the extension of City boundary by taking in portions of the districts of St. Paul's Foleshill and Parishes of Stoke and St. Michael Without into the Sherborne Valley, 20 Oct 1897, Meeting of the Boundary Sub Committee - to consider report from City
Engineer on proposals to incorporate parts of the Parishes of Foleshill, Stoke, St. Michael Without and Holy
Trinity Without, 15 Nov 1897, 18 Nov 1897, Council in Committee - appointed a sub committee from the Sanitary Committee to report on the steps taken to end the trouble caused by the sewage of Foleshill making its way into the City. Also General Works Committee appointed sub committee to confer on the resolution of Foleshill Rural District Council in favour of inclusion within the City, 23 Nov 1897.
